    Double-glazed units or insulated glass units (IGUs) are composed of two panes with an in-between space that is filled with air or other gases like argon or krypton to provide insulation. They are a great way to enhance the appearance of your home and keep it energy efficient.

    One of the biggest factors that affects a window's performance is the quality of the materials used to make it. This includes the type of glass and sealant used to create the window. The sealant's performance will determine the length of time the window will last and whether it's waterproof.

    Over time the sealant may become loose or break down and allow air and moisture in. This can cause condensation to develop within the double-glazing unit. This is an indication of a damaged sealant which needs to be replaced.

    Condensation occurs most often in multi-paned windows, and is typically noticed as fogging. The inner panes have a spacer that is filled with desiccant. This chemical absorbs moisture that is between the glass. This seal could be damaged by even the smallest chip or crack, reducing the insulating properties of the multi-paned windows.

    Modern replacement windows are more likely to prevent this issue because they are made with Warm Edge technology, which reduces thermal transfer around the glass's perimeter. This is accomplished by using the one-piece of insulating glass spacer of neoprene or vinyl that can flex with the expansion and contraction of the glass. This will not only extend the lifespan of the IG unit, but also prevent condensation from forming between the panes.

    Many people install slim double glazing units in their period homes to bring their home into the 21st Century without changing the appearance of the frame. These units are constructed to fit inside rebates that were originally intended for single glazing of 4-5mm. However, they do not always fit perfectly and can be difficult to clean.

    These units are advertised as having a sightline between 8 and 10 millimeters. However, they employ a "warm edge" spacer bar that reduces visibility. To attain this sightline, the sealant on the back of the unit needs to be reduced in thickness. This can have a serious impact on the IGU’s ability to resist moisture and gas loss, which can lead to premature IGU failure.

    They will not comply with the thermal performance requirements of Part 2 and 3. This requires an absolute minimum of 8mm above the bar spacer. This can result in reducing the thermal efficiency of the unit by about 10 percent. The producers of these units offer a guarantee on their products that they will meet the requirements However, these tests are not conducted on these reduced sightline narrow cavity units and are therefore incorrect.
